About 12 Cromwell Close
12 Cromwell Close is a three-bedroom detached house in Cromer (NR27 0DE). It has a recorded floor area of 98 m² (around 1055 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2026)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in April 2009 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good, lighting went from Poor to Good and main heating went from Average to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 74). This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ition.
Held since December 2009 — that's 17 years off the open market, well above the local norm.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. Today's modelled estimate of £354,000 is 45.7% above the 2009 sale price.
